Transaction cfb57597bd9fefcac7325431a4f6dd6d0bdd9cc6085876ccec1fc30a04339e4e
1 Input
1 Output
-
cfb57597bd9fefcac7325431a4f6dd6d0bdd9cc6085876ccec1fc30a04339e4e:0
- value
- 23911456
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 39521cbf7430a68e3fb24e5dcd7b143b36dfe217 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16E5tCQiRYTMj9ZMskuQbzrq5JATiaXBk2